The Hybrid Powertrain
Years after the standard internal combustion engine (ICE) hybrid powertrain was introduced in two distinct types. The first one was the hybrid, also known as an HEV – Hybrid Electric Vehicle. Although the hybrid powertrain relied on fuel, it used a new technology whereby the engine was paired with an electric motor and a small battery pack. With the hybrid technology, the engine performance and efficiency performed and results in better fuel economy.
To put it simply, hybrid vehicles are powered by an internal combustion engine and one or more electric motors that use battery energy. Which means instead of just one standard power output, there is a combined power output.
The other type of hybrid powertrain is the plug-in hybrid. This is also similarly configured. Much like hybrid powertrains, it works with an ICE engine, an electric motor and a battery pack. However, hybrid car batteries are bigger and last longer. Instead of just boosting the engine, this setup can power the car completely on its own.
Both these options are eco-friendly options.
The Electric Car Powertrain
Just like hybrids, electric car powertrains also come in different types including battery-electric vehicle (BEV) and the fuel-cell electric vehicle (FCEV) also known as water-hybrid car.
The most common types of EVs are battery-electric vehicles. They are equipped with one to four motors and a powerful battery pack. The electric powertrain is very powerful, and also helps tackle climate change.
On the other hand, hydrogen systems for cars are relatively new and haven’t really taken off in the mainstream market. That said, a hydrogen engine is really efficient and much cleaner than a regular EV. This is because household electricity is often produced via less-than-green methods.
Unfortunately, not many places have the infrastructure to supply fuel cells for hydrogen cars.
Hybrid Vs Electric Car Powertrain – Which is Better
When it comes to a comparison between electric vs hybrid car powertrains, both come with their own set of advantages and disadvantages. Let’s go through them in detail.
Benefits of Hybrid Car Powertrain
- Established and trusted technology
- Some hybrid car models are also available at economical prices
- Have the safety of being powered by fuel
- Easy to maintain
- Batteries are extensive
- Improved fuel economy
Disadvantages of Hybrid Car Powertrain
- Limited electric range
- Not as green as EVs
Benefits of Electric Car Powertrain
- Powerful and efficient powertrains
- Reduced carbon emission
- Safe, quite and high-tech
Disadvantages of Electric Car Powertrain
- Limited models when compared to hybrids
- Requires special charges
- Charge timings can be long
